EXCLUSIVE: 2nd Day Box Office Collection Of Spider-Man: Across the Spider-Verse, Drops By 15%!

Hollywood’s Spider-Man: Across the Spider-Verse is the sequel to the 2018 animated film Spider-Man: Into the Spider-Verse. The movie is the first of two planned sequels, with the second one titled Spider-Man: Beyond the Spider-Verse. The sequel was originally set for release on April 8, 2022, but was delayed to October 7, 2022, and then to June 2, 2023, due to the COVID-19 pandemic.

Film released in close to 1900-2000 screens in India and should do well at box office.

2nd Day Box Office Collection Of Spider Man

Film opened well and with very good reviews it got much needed push. Despite being an animation film, it registered good 4.20 cr nett at box office on day one all India. Film dropped on day two due to competition from new releases and Thursday release factor.

As per early trends, film should collect 3.65 cr nett on day two which is 20% drop from day one. Film has 2 – day total of 7.85 cr nett and it should cross 15 cr nett at best over the weekend.

Following are the collections for the film:

Thursday: 4.20 cr

Friday: 3.65 cr

Total: 7.85 cr Nett

Plot And Voice Over Cast Of Spider Man Across The Spider Verse

The exact plot of the movie is still unknown, but it is expected to follow Miles Morales as he reunites with his friends Spider-Gwen and Peter B. Parker, and teams up with Spider-Man 2099, Spider-Punk, and the original Spider-Woman, Jessica Drew.

Shameik Moore will reprise his role as Miles Morales. Oscar Isaac will voice Spider-Man. Other cast members include Hailee Steinfeld, Jake Johnson, John Mulaney, and Issa Rae.

The first trailer for the movie was released on November 2021. The trailer picks up right where the last film left off, with Miles listening to the hit song from Into the Spider-Verse “Sunflower” by Post Malone and Swae Lee. 

Spider-Man: Across the Spider-Verse is directed by Joaquim Dos Santos, Kemp Powers, and Justin K. Thompson, in their feature directorial debuts5. The movie is highly anticipated by fans of the first film, and it is expected to explore the idea of Spider-Man variants crossing paths.
